If your shed feels like an oven, too cold, or full of moisture, insulation can be the solution. Here are the top problems barn owners face when their structure isn’t insulated:

Extreme Temperatures

Without insulation, a pole barn can get unbearably hot in summer and feel like an icebox. This makes it hard to use year-round and can shorten the lifespan of stored items.

Condensation & Moisture Issues

Uninsulated pole barns often trap moisture, leading to corrosion, fungus, and even structural damage. This can cause long-term structural damage over time.

Wasted Heating & Cooling

If you heat or air condition your pole barn, poor insulation means money is going to waste. Insulation locks in heat during winter and reduces overheating, lowering energy bills.

Loud & Uncomfortable Acoustics

A metal building without insulation can be loud and echoey. Insulation absorbs sound, making it a more comfortable area.

Unwanted Elements Sneaking Inside

Gaps in an uninsulated metal shed allow dust, bugs, and mice. Insulation creates a barrier, keeping your area protected.

Faster Wear & Tear on Equipment & Supplies

Uncontrolled temperatures and moisture can damage tools, equipment, vehicles, and stored items. Insulation extends the life of your valuables and prevents wear and tear.

What Is Pole Barn Insulation?

Pole barn insulation is designed to insulate your building. It keeps heat inside during the winter and blocks extreme heat in the summer, creating a comfortable environment. It also helps reduce humidity, which can lead to rust.

Lakeville, Massachusetts, is a quaint town with a rich history dating back to the early 18th century. Originally settled as a part of Middleborough, Lakeville officially became its own town in 1853. With its beautiful scenery, friendly community, and top-rated schools, it’s no wonder why Lakeville is considered a great place to live.

Residents of Lakeville enjoy the peacefulness of country living while still being just a short drive away from major cities like Boston and Providence. The town is home to several parks and lakes, perfect for outdoor activities like hiking, fishing, and boating. With its charming downtown area, residents can also enjoy shopping and dining in a lovely, small-town setting.
